As I recently had my HW cylinder replaced and we had to leave disconnected the solar thermal system from the HW cylinder and drained out the old glycol. What is involved in re-filling the thermal system with new glycol in terms of number of hours of labour and materials? I got a quote for a bit over £600 which is for 5 hours of work and £200 worth of materials. Is this a reasonable amount? Thanks!
 
Depends where you are in the country and how much travel is needed to get between you and base, etc. If you aren't happy with the quote, get another company to give you one.

Be careful about using price as your only criterion for choosing – consider reputation and expertise as well. Cheapskates often end up unhappy with the work done or even have to pay twice because a new competent firm is needed to sort out the mess made by the first!
